There's no place like home for Columbia, who bounced back after a loss on the road last Tuesday. They walked away with a 50-37 win over the La Center Wildcats on Thursday. That's the second time they've managed to beat them this season, as they also won 35-25 on January 6th.

Columbia pushed their record up to 10-4 with the victory, which was their sixth straight at home. As for La Center, they are on a three-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 6-10.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Columbia will host Seton Catholic at 7:00 p.m. on Monday. La Center has already played their next game (against Stevenson), but no score has been uploaded at the time of writing.
